There is no wifi at home. The hub's light is red but the website says the connection is good. Please help!

Try running this line test to see if it finds any faults:
https://www.sky.com/help/articles/broadband-diagnostic-start
You can also run the test via the MySky app on a mobile data connection.
After this has finished and if it reports back all is good click on broadband to run an updated test. If you get amber or red please follow the on screen instructions.
